@charset "utf-8";html{background:#f7f7f7;color:#333;font-size:32px}
body,ul,ol,li,dl,dd,h1,h2,h3,h4,h5,h6,figure,form,fieldset,legend,input,textarea,button,p,blockquote,th,td,pre,xmp{margin:0;padding:0}
body,input,textarea,button,select,pre,tt,code,kbd,samp,optgroup,option{font-family:"微软雅黑","黑体"}
::-webkit-input-placeholder{color:#c7ced4}
:-moz-placeholder{color:#c7ced4}
::-moz-placeholder{color:#c7ced4}
:-ms-input-placeholder{color:#c7ced4}
input[type="text"]{color:#333}
input.error{box-shadow:0 0 2px #ff4500}
table{border-collapse:collapse;border-spacing:0;text-align:left}
caption,th{text-align:inherit}
ul,ol,li,menu{list-style:none}
fieldset,img{border:0 none}
img,object,input,textarea,button,select{vertical-align:top}
article,aside,footer,header,section,nav,figure,figcaption,hgroup,details,menu{display:block}
audio,canvas,video{display:block;*display:inline;*zoom:1}
h1,h2,h3,h4,h5,h6,input,textarea,button,select,small{font-size:100%}
address,cite,dfn,em,i,optgroup,var{font-style:normal}
blockquote:before,blockquote:after,q:before,q:after{content:'\0020'}
textarea{overflow:auto}
textarea,input{outline:0}
mark{background-color:#ffc40d}
ins,s,u,del{text-decoration:none}
a{color:#000;text-decoration:none}
.rmb{font-weight:normal;font-size:12px;font-family:arial}
.num{font-family:Tahoma,Simsum}
.color01{color:#ff075b}
#hd,#bd,#ft,.hd,.bd,.ft,.g-clear,.g-mod,.g-mod .inner{*zoom:1}
#hd:after,#bd:after,#ft:after,.hd:after,.bd:after,.ft:after,.g-clear:after,.g-mod:after,.g-mod .inner:after{display:block;overflow:hidden;height:0;clear:both;content:'\0020'}
body{font-size:13px;margin:0 auto}
.clear{clear:both;height:0;line-height:0}
.clear:after{content:".";height:0;line-height:0;visibility:hidden;clear:both}
.clearfix:after{content:".";display:block;height:0;clear:both;visibility:hidden}
.bm_header{width:100%;height:90px;background:#fff;font-size:14px}
.bm_header .navBox{height:90px;max-width:1200px;min-width:980px;_width:1200px;margin:0 auto;line-height:90px;text-align:center}
.bm_header a.home{float:left;width:192px;height:56px;margin-top:16px}
.bm_header ul.nav{float:right;margin-top:30px;margin-right:58px}
.bm_header ul.nav li{float:left;width:96px;margin:0 2px;*position:relative}
.bm_header ul.nav li a{display:block;width:100%;height:30px;line-height:30px;color:#7d7d7d;margin-bottom:13px}
.bm_header ul.nav li a.on{color:#32abe3;font-weight:bold}
.bm_header ul.nav li ul.menu{text-align:center;background-color:#f7f7f7;width:190px;border-color:9px solid #f7f7f7;box-shadow:2px 2px 4px #999;position:absolute;*left:0;display:none}
.bm_header ul.nav li ul.menu li{box-shadow:0 1px 3px #e2e2e2;margin:0;width:100%}
.bm_header ul.nav li ul.menu li:nth-child(1):before{-moz-border-bottom-colors:none;-moz-border-left-colors:none;-moz-border-right-colors:none;-moz-border-top-colors:none;border-color:transparent transparent #f7f7f7;border-image:none;border-style:solid;border-width:9px;content:"";height:1px;position:absolute;right:45px;top:-19px;width:1px}
.bm_header ul.nav li ul.menu li a{height:40px;line-height:40px;color:#7d7d7d;display:block;margin:0;border-radius:3px}
.bm_header ul.nav li ul.menu li a:hover{background-color:#32abe3;color:#fff;text-decoration:none}
.bm_header a.apply{float:right;background-color:#4ed7d9;border-radius:10px;height:40px;line-height:40px;margin:27px auto;color:#fff;text-align:center;width:150px}
.bm_header a.apply:visited{color:#fff;text-decoration:none}
.bm_footer{background:none repeat scroll 0 0 #fff;clear:both;color:#666;font-size:12px;padding-bottom:24px;padding-top:24px;text-align:center;width:100%}
.bm_banner{width:100%;min-width:1200px;margin:0 auto;height:960px;}
.bm_banner div.bm_content{height:554px;width:100%;margin:0 auto;}
.bm_banner div.bm_content div.bm_contentLeft{float:left;width:600px;height:500px;padding:117px 91px;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;-o-box-sizing:border-box;-ms-box-sizing:border-box;box-sizing:border-box;position:relative}
.bm_banner div.bm_content div.bm_contentLeft img{width:418px;height:366px}
.bm_banner div.bm_content div.bm_contentLeft div.bm_appBtn{position:relative;top:-42px;width:170px;height:45px;width:170px;height:45px;background:#4ed7d9;border-radius:8px;font-size:18px}
.bm_banner div.bm_content div.bm_contentLeft div.bm_appBtn a img{width:170px;height:45px;vertical-align:middle}
.bm_banner ul.bm_icoList{position:relative;margin-top:100px;list-style-type:none;z-index:2;text-align:center}
.bm_banner ul.bm_icoList li{display:inline-block;width:230px;z-index:1;color:#fff}
.bm_banner ul.bm_icoList li h4{font-size:18px;margin:20px auto;font-weight:normal}
.bm_banner ul.bm_icoList li p{font-size:12px;line-height:24px}
.bm_serviceObject{clear:both;margin:20px auto;margin-bottom:100px;width:100%;max-width:1200px;height:auto;overflow:hidden}
.bm_serviceObject h3{font-size:24px;color:#7d7d7d;text-align:center;font-weight:normal}
.bm_serviceObject ul{margin:0;margin-top:55px;padding:0;list-style-type:none;color:#fff}
.bm_serviceObject ul li{float:left;width:23%;height:200px;border-radius:80px;-o-border-radius:80px}
.bm_serviceObject ul li.first{background:#61dfe1;margin-right:2%}
.bm_serviceObject ul li.second{background:#75c2e6;margin-right:2%}
.bm_serviceObject ul li.seconds{background:#75c223;margin-right:2%}
.bm_serviceObject ul li.third{background:#67da9a}
.bm_serviceObject ul li div.serviceList{margin:20px auto}
.bm_serviceObject ul li div.serviceList span{display:inline-block;margin-left:110px;}
.bm_serviceObject ul li div.serviceList span img{border:0;vertical-align:super}
.bm_serviceObject ul li div.serviceList div.wzzs{display:inline-block; text-align: center; width: 100%}
.bm_serviceObject ul li div.serviceList div.wzzs h2{font-size:24px;padding-bottom:15px;font-weight:normal}
.bm_serviceObject ul li div.serviceList div.wzzs p{font-size:14px;line-height:25px}
